So, when you’re on the hunt for some quality furniture for your home, it’s super important to check out the materials it’s made from. You know, things like durability and overall quality really matter if you want your furniture to last and keep you happy over the years. For example, pieces made from solid hardwoods usually hold up way better under the daily wear and tear than those made from softer woods or composites. The natural toughness of hardwood not only makes it last longer but also looks pretty great, so you’re really making a solid investment for the future.
But it’s not just about the wood! The finish and upholstery materials play a big role too. Going for natural finishes and top-notch upholstery fabrics, like leather or those heavy-duty textiles, can really help your furniture stand the test of time while keeping it cozy and good-looking. By checking out these materials, you’re not only gauging how good the furniture is right now but also how well it’ll hold up down the road. If you focus on durability and quality right from the start, you’ll end up with a living space that not only looks fantastic but can handle the hustle and bustle of everyday life.
| Material | Durability Rating | Maintenance Level | Environmental Impact | Cost Per Unit |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Solid Wood | High | Low | Moderate | $200 - $500 |
| Plywood | Moderate | Medium | Low | $100 - $300 |
| Metal | Very High | Low | Low | $150 - $400 |
| Fabric (Natural Fibers) | Low to Moderate | High | Moderate | $50 - $300 |
| Leather | High | Medium | Moderate to High | $300 - $800 |

Choosing the right furniture for your home is all about quality and sustainability, don’t you think? It's pretty eye-opening when you see that the Sustainable Furnishings Council reported a whopping 200% increase in the demand for eco-friendly furniture in recent years. This really shows how more and more folks are becoming aware of the impact their choices have on the environment. People are increasingly leaning towards materials that are sustainably sourced—think reclaimed wood and bamboo, which are becoming super popular because they leave a smaller carbon footprint.
And here’s something you might find interesting: the World Wildlife Fund has shared that using furniture made from sustainably harvested materials can really help cut down on deforestation, a major issue that many parts of the world are grappling with. So, when you choose to support manufacturers who stick to eco-friendly practices, you’re not just decking out your home nicely; you’re also doing your bit for the planet! Look for features like non-toxic finishes and check if they have certifications from reputable organizations, like the Forest Stewardship Council, which ensures that the wood is responsibly sourced. Embracing eco-friendly furniture isn’t just a passing fad—it's a smart lifestyle choice that plays a part in creating a healthier environment for future generations.

In recent years, the importance of ergonomic design in School Furniture has gained significant attention, driven by a growing awareness of its impact on students' learning environments. The latest studies reveal that comfortable and appropriately designed furniture can enhance focus, reduce distractions, and ultimately improve academic performance. For instance, ergonomic chairs and adjustable desks not only promote better posture but also allow children to find their optimal working position, adapting to their unique body shapes and sizes.
As schools strive to create more conducive learning environments, selecting the right products becomes essential. Ergonomic school furniture, such as adjustable height desks and supportive seating options, is pivotal in fostering an atmosphere where children can thrive. These innovations cater to the diverse needs of students, helping to alleviate discomfort associated with prolonged sitting. Furthermore, incorporating flexible furniture arrangements supports collaborative learning and encourages active participation in group activities, making the learning experience more engaging.
Investing in high-quality ergonomic furniture not only benefits students physically but also contributes to their overall well-being and success. By providing an environment that prioritizes comfort and health, educators can facilitate better learning outcomes and foster a generation of learners who are equipped to excel in their academic endeavors.
